Paver Driveway Installation in Denver, CO
Paver driveway installation is a popular choice for homeowners seeking a durable and attractive surface for their property. This service involves laying interlocking pavers made from materials such as concrete, brick, or stone to create a customized driveway that enhances curb appeal. Projects typically include replacing old, cracked, or uneven driveways or creating new paved surfaces that provide a sturdy foundation for vehicles. Property owners often want to understand the different paver options available, the overall design possibilities, and how the installation process may impact their property during construction.
Before requesting paver driveway installation, homeowners usually consider factors such as the size and layout of the driveway, the type of pavers that best suit their aesthetic preferences, and the durability needed for their climate. It’s also helpful to understand the maintenance requirements and how the chosen materials will perform over time. Clarifying these details can ensure the finished driveway meets expectations for style, functionality, and longevity, making it a practical investment for property improvement.

Paver Driveway Installation Questions
What types of materials are used for paver driveways?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, offering durability and aesthetic appeal for various property styles.
Can paver driveways be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, pavers can often be installed over existing concrete or asphalt, provided the surface is stable and properly prepared.
What are the benefits of choosing paver driveways? Paver driveways provide a customizable look, good drainage, and easy repair options compared to traditional concrete or asphalt surfaces.
How should property owners maintain a paver driveway? Regular cleaning and occasional re-sanding help maintain the appearance and stability of paver driveways over time.
